Understanding and drafting the Power of Attorney Complete all relevant documentation. Conduct interviews with relevant parties. … Webb8 juli 2024 · What is transfer duty? Transfer duty is a tax levied on the sale of a fixed property acquired by any person by way of a transaction or in any other way. On average, the process takes around three months from the date of sale until the property is registered in the new … WebbProperty Transfer Process in South Africa. Transferring property in South Africa refers to the legal process of one party giving full or partial ownership of immovable property to another party.
